Solution Overview

Problem

Harley-Davidson motorcycles, particularly touring and soft tail series, face difficulties in reversing due to their weight and complex driving mechanisms, making it inconvenient to install a reverse gear without significant modifications.

Innovation Solution

A reverse gear apparatus for Harley-Davidson motorcycles, comprising a bracket main body with a handle part and mounting part, a clutch connector, and a driving apparatus, which can be mounted externally without altering the existing driving mechanism, utilizing a gear or belt pulley transmission structure to enable reverse rotation.

The present invention relates to the technical field of reverse gears, and in particular to a reverse gear apparatus for a Harley-Davidson motorcycle, and specifically refers to a reverse gear apparatus for a 6-speed gearbox for Harley-Davidson touring and soft tail series. The reverse gear apparatus includes: a handle part and a mounting part connected to one end of the handle part, where the handle part is used for mounting a driving apparatus, to serve as a power source for driving a driven shaft of a power apparatus connected with the motorcycle to rotate; a clutch connector is mounted on the mounting part, one end of the clutch connector is fixedly connected with the driven shaft of the power apparatus of the motorcycle, and the other end of the clutch connector is connected with the driving apparatus.
